Abstract
The organizers of the Workshop have requested that I summarize the very thorough coverage of mass loss from diverse astrophysical souces presented over the past five days. Clearly this id an impossible task and I cannot pretend to do it justice. During the 31 years since Deutch (1956) first presented indisputable evidence for mass loss from the α Her system, the topic of mass loss has grown to be a major research area in astrophysics. The review papers presented at this Workshop summarize the current status of this field.
